Road Accident Kills 19, Injures 30 Others in Morocco’s Khouribga

Rabat – A fatal road accident after the overturning of a bus killed 19 people while 30 others sustained injuries on a national road linking Khouribga with Fquih Bensalah, in the Beni Mellal Khenifra region on Wednesday.

The incident took place in Boulanouare, an area five kilometers from Khouribga.

Local authorities, Royal Gendarmerie, as well as civil protection services rushed to the scene immediately after the accident.

Services transferred the remains of the road accident victims to the morgue while the injured were evacuated to the nearest health facilities in the region for medical care.

Authorities have opened an investigation to determine the cause of the accident.

20 people died while 2,244 were injured, including 76 in serious condition during at least 1,577 road accidents across Morocco between August 8-14.

According to a press release from the General Directorate of National Security (DGSN), the accidents are due to different reasons, including driver negligence, failure to respect road signs, excessive speed, non-vigilance of pedestrians, failure to respect the safety distance, as well as change of direction without using the turn signal.

Security services handed over 47,663 fines and filed 6,532 reports for road traffic offenses committed during the same period.
